    This is my first post to the forum. I recently acquired my first IWC, the Aquatimer 2000 ref. IW3568-10, the black/yellow version on rubber strap. I wanted to have the bracelet too, so I ordered one from the AD at the same time I bought the watch. The bracelet arrived and it was all brushed. Having seen pictures online, I have mostly seen bracelets with polished center links on the black/yellow 3568. My bracelet came in a small box with the ref. IWA55585.

    I would be most grateful, if anyone could shed some light to this matter. Do I have a proper bracelet for my watch? Are both types sold on the black/yellow version?

    I think the earlier version came with polished center links and simple pusher clasp while the later version with all-brushed surface and a more solid double-pusher clasp (unfortunately neither have the micro-adjust feature, hopefully the AT 2014 models will soon have...). I think both changes were executed more or less at the same time, around 2011-2012. So both bracelet versions are authentic. Hope this helps.
